Single nucleotide polymorphisms of TCF7L2 are linked to diabetic coronary atherosclerosis.
PloS one - 15 Mar 2011
Muendlein Axel, Saely Christoph H, Geller-Rhomberg Simone, Sonderegger Gudrun, Rein Philipp, Winder Thomas, Beer Stefan, Vonbank Alexander, Drexel Heinz
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: Coronary artery disease (CAD) shares common risk factors with type 2 diabetes (T2DM). Variations in the transcription factor 7-like 2 (TCF7L2) gene, particularly rs7903146, increase T2DM risk. Potential links between genetic variants of the TCF7L2 locus and coronary atherosclerosis are uncertain. We therefore investigated the association between TCF7L2 polymorphisms and angiographically determined CAD...
